YEREVAN, November 28. /ARKA/. Armenian President Serzh Sargsyan participated Saturday in the opening of a new medical center in Gavar, the administrative capital of Gegharkunik province.
In Gavar the President visited фдыщ the Center for Children Development and Rehabilitation (CCDR) – the Gavar branch of the Gegharkunik marz Arabkir Medical Center-Institute for Children and Adolescents Health (Arabkir MC-ICAH). The President toured the premise of the Center, familiarized with the conditions and quality of the servicesб his press service reported.
To provide for an early detection of the children with special needs in the marzes, assessment of their development and to make their rehabilitation affordable, Arabkir MC-ICAH with the assistance of the RA Ministry of Health in 2003 initiated the establishment in the marzes of Armenia of the Centers for Children Development and Rehabilitation.
The President of Armenia was informed that the CCDR in Gavar, which has been operational since 2008, was a small one and had no capacity to provide medical services to all children of the marz. Thus, in 2010-2011 the Arabkir MC-ICAH, assisted by different organizations and sponsors established and furnished in this town another, a more spacious and comfortable center. The Center provides services to the children residing in Gegharkunik with physical, mental, hearing, speech and communication disabilities and other disorders. The Center can serve up to 200 children each year, receiving more that 15000 visits. It was also noted that the former CCDR will be serving as an information and training Resource center for the children’s development and disability prevention.
In Gavar, Serzh Sargsyan attended also the ceremony of inauguration of the Gavar Medical Center, where he familiarized with the optimization and investment programs and capacities of this medical establishment.
He was also informed that in the framework of the Program of Modernization of the Health Care system, conducted jointly by the World Bank and the Government of Armenia, the Gavar Medical Center was established by merging together the Gavar hospital and maternity home. In total, almost 3835 m2 area has been renovated and built and, in particular, a unit of the medical center has been totally renovated.
The construction of the morgue and renovation of the unit of contagious diseases have also been started. In the framework of the program the hospital has been equipped with modern devices for the reception area, intensive care, diagnosis department and operating rooms; in addition the hospital has been furnished with medical and office furniture. The medical center has also a telecommunication system with the leading clinics in Yerevan which allows to conduct medical counselling. -0-
